Abner Kimball
(Richard,
Benjamin, Ebenezer,
Abraham)
Abner was born in Haverhill, MA on April 10, 1755 and died on March 11, 1818.
He married on December 18, 1781 to Abigail Gage of Bradford, MA. She was born in 1761 and died on May 24, 1803.
He married 2nd, on July 10, 1803, to Mrs. Mercy (Judkins) Colby, the widow of Anthony Colby. She died on January 28, 1865, in her 99th year.
He was a private in Capt. Ebenezer Colby's Co. in April 19, 1775. On August 15, 1777, he enlisted in Capt. Carr's Co. for three years. He was discharged on February 12, 1780. He enlisted on August 12, 1781, as sergeant in James Mallon's Co., Putnam's Regt., and was in the same company on September 5, 1782.
He removed from Haverhill, MA to Sanbornton, NH.
CHILDREN:
1. Rebecca (6), b. 14 Jul 1783; d. 30 Sep 1826; m. 20 Mar 1803, James Cawley of New Hampton NH
2. Hannah (6), b. 31 May 1785; d. 26 Nov 1867; m. 14 Sep 1802, Samuel Hersey. She was a member of the Baptist church and an earnest Christian.
3. Moses (6-800), b. 27 Feb 1787; d. 20 Sep 1848
4. Abigail (6), b. 4 Mar 1793; d. Sanbornton, NH, 5 Jan 1827; m. 1 Feb 1819, Levi Wallace
5. Abner (6-801), b. 14 Oct 1805. Resided in Sanbornton.
